Jane Lampton Clemens
Mother of Samuel Clemens
Core Belief
"Integrity and kindness are essential, but one must maintain a sense of humor and perspective in the face of life's challenges."
Worldview
A blend of frontier practicality and refined sensibility, tempered by a deep-seated religious conviction.
Personality
Possessing a rare ability to deliver humorous remarks with a perfectly straight face. Strong-willed, compassionate, and deeply religious, yet able to reconcile her faith with a sharp wit and a critical eye.
In Their Own Words
"“She had a sort of ability which is rare in man and hardly existent in woman--the ability to say a humorous thing with the perfect air of not knowing it to be humorous.”"
"“Sammy will pull through; he wasn't born to die that way.”"
"“Oh yes, I know his average. I discount him ninety per cent. The rest is pure gold.”"
